By default the SegmentMK uses optimistic locking when committing changes to a
given journal. This works well most of the time, but there a few scenarios when
this strategy will fail. For example:
# A large batch operation while other smaller changes are being committed.
# Lots of concurrent changes being committed against the same journal.
In such cases optimistic locking will lead to some changes being delayed
indefinitely, whereas pessimistic locking can guarantee eventual completion of
all operations at the cost of potentially significantly reduced throughput. See
http://markmail.org/message/dl3semmp577bnqoi for related discussion.
As a hybrid solution that attempts to combine the best aspects of both
optimistic and pessimistic locking, we should make the SegmentMK fall back to
pessimism if optimistic locking fails after some N attempts or X seconds.
